.mov loop won't butt
 
I bought some loops from footage firm and they came in HD .mov format (30fps@1920x1080). I then had to D/L quicktime for my SVP10c. However, the loop won't butt together to make a larger seamless loop. There's a small gap. I've even taken off the snapping and auto-cross-fades but it then overlaps and screws up the whole loop even more. What gives?

Re: .mov loop won't butt
 
Remove that source from your timeline
Make sure "quantize to frames" is turned on.
Turn snapping back on.
Leave auto-crossfade off.
Drag a couple copies to the timeline.

Works?

Make sure you try a render...

I *think* you can just drag the right edge of a clip to the right to cause looping as well, could be wrong about this.
